Introduction to Incinerators

Incinerators are devices that burn waste materials, such as medical waste, at high temperatures, reducing the volume of waste and killing any pathogens that may be present. The use of incinerators in hospitals is essential for managing medical waste, which can include items such as used needles, syringes, bandages, and other materials that have come into contact with infectious bodily fluids. Medical waste can pose a significant risk to public health if not disposed of properly, as it can harbor diseases such as HIV, hepatitis, and tuberculosis.

The Role of Incinerators in Preventing the Spread of Diseases

The introduction of incinerators at Gihanga Hospital has revolutionized the way medical waste is managed. Incinerators provide a safe and efficient way to dispose of medical waste, reducing the risk of disease transmission and protecting the environment. The incinerators used at Gihanga Hospital are designed to burn medical waste at high temperatures, typically between 800°C to 1300°C, which is sufficient to kill any pathogens that may be present. The ash residue that is left after incineration is non-hazardous and can be safely disposed of in a landfill.

Challenges and Limitations

While incinerators have been effective in preventing the spread of diseases at Gihanga Hospital, there are still challenges and limitations to their use. Some of the key challenges include:

  1. High operating costs: Incinerators require significant amounts of fuel to operate, which can be expensive and unsustainable in the long term.
  2. Maintenance and repair: Incinerators require regular maintenance and repair to ensure that they are functioning properly, which can be time-consuming and costly.
  3. Limited capacity: Incinerators have limited capacity, which can lead to backlog and accumulation of medical waste if not managed properly.
  4. Environmental concerns: Incinerators can release harmful pollutants, such as dioxins and furans, into the atmosphere, which can harm the environment and human health.
